The Commissioner for Education and Knowledge Management, Dr. Fredrick Ikyaan, in collaboration with Topaz Olivetti Limited, Consultant to the EDUPORTAL project, is pleased to announce the school onboarding onto the EMIS/EDUPORTAL, a state-of-the-art Educational Management Information System (EMIS). He was at Josephines International International School, North Bank, Makurdi yesterday to witness the kick-start of the onboarding.

Benue Govt Warns Against Data Falsification In School Census

Education Secretaries from the 23 Local Government areas and 10 area offices in Benue State are participating in this training on data capturing as part of the 2024/2025 School Census in the State. The State Government is using the census to gather data on the status of schools, as well as to address corruption in public schools in the State.

Benue Govt Introduces Education Management Information System

The Benue State government has commissioned the Education Management Information System, EMIS-Eduportal, to provide modules for teachers to share lesson plans with students and parents in advance.
Benue is the second state after Kaduna to set up this system.
